Product Description: m-PEG8-ethoxycarbonyl-propanoic acid is widely used in bioconjugation and drug delivery systems due to its biocompatibility and water solubility. It serves as a linker molecule, enabling the attachment of therapeutic agents or targeting ligands to nanoparticles or proteins, enhancing their stability and circulation time in the body. In pharmaceutical research, it is utilized to modify peptides, proteins, and small molecules, improving their pharmacokinetic properties and reducing immunogenicity. Additionally, it finds applications in the development of hydrogels and biomaterials for tissue engineering, where it contributes to controlled release mechanisms and scaffold functionalization. Its PEGylation properties also make it valuable in creating stealth liposomes and other nanocarriers for targeted cancer therapy.
